West Virginia University At Parkersburg


West Virginia University at Parkersburg, also known as WVUP, is located in Parkersburg, United States. It was established in 1961 as the Parkersburg Branch of West Virginia University. In 1971, it was renamed to Parkersburg Community College. It gained university status in 1989 and adopted its present name. It is a regional campus of West Virginia University or WVU. The university enrolls more than 3, 500 part-time and full-time students per year. The university grants several associate degrees and certificate programs in diverse Course Topics. WVUP recognizes a number of student organizations and clubs including the Criminal Justice Club, Musicians Guild, Student Nursing Association, Film Society, Psychology Club, and Give Back on Fridays. The Student Government Association works for the overall development of students.
